Liverpool were forced to work hard against Norwich City but, in the end, they got the job done.Jurgen Klopp’s side, who’d won 24 of their 25 league fixtures prior to their trip to Carrow Road, eventually found the breakthrough thanks to Sadio Mane’s superb 80th-minute winner.In what was a surprisingly even contest between the Premier League’s top and bottom sides, Norwich not only defended resolutely but also threatened to take the lead on a couple of occasions.In the end, though, it was the league leaders who scored the winning goal. The Premier League trophy is surely heading to Anfield in the next few weeks.For Liverpool’s first-team stars, this was their first game since beating Southampton 4-0 on February 1.

But the two-week break appeared to have done little other than disrupt the Reds’ momentum.

However, just when it looked as if Liverpool might drop points for only the second time this season, substitute Mane popped up to score his 100th goal in English football.

VAR reviewed the incident for a suspected push by the Senegalese winger but, following a brief stoppage, the goal was allowed to stand.

The result means Liverpool increase their lead over second-placed Manchester City, who face West Ham in their rescheduled fixture on Wednesday.
